Skip to content

Commit c268b59

Browse files
Check DC flag for headers
1 parent 70e6eb4 commit c268b59

File tree

1 file changed

+6
-4
lines changed

1 file changed

+6
-4
lines changed

Sources/Internal/GrpcClient.swift

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-266,10 +266,12 @@ actor GrpcClient: CustomStringConvertible {
266266
func createCallOptions() async -> CallOptions {
267267
var headers = HPACKHeaders()
268268

269-
headers.add(name: RequestHeaders.googRequestParamsHeader, value: googRequestHeaderValue)
270-
headers.add(name: RequestHeaders.firebaseAppId, value: app.options.googleAppID)
271-
headers.add(name: RequestHeaders.googApiClient, value: googApiClientHeaderValue)
272-
269+
if self.app.isDataCollectionDefaultEnabled {
270+
headers.add(name: RequestHeaders.googRequestParamsHeader, value: googRequestHeaderValue)
271+
headers.add(name: RequestHeaders.firebaseAppId, value: app.options.googleAppID)
272+
headers.add(name: RequestHeaders.googApiClient, value: googApiClientHeaderValue)
273+
}
274+
273275
// Add Auth token if available
274276
do {
275277
if let token = try await auth.currentUser?.getIDToken() {

0 commit comments

Comments
 (0)